1625 DB25F I/O Adapter Cable

1625 DB25F I/O Adapter Cable

The 1625 DB25F I/O Adapter Cable connects all the pins (but the pin 1) of a 26-pin dual-row 0.1" pitch connector to a 25-pin female SubD connector fitted into a standard-profile PC bracket.

Usage with Internal IO2 connector

Applies to:

The adapter brings the second set of I/O lines and the +12V power output to a bracket-mount SubD connector. The pins are assigned as follows:

Wire # IDC Pin # SubD Pin # Signal Name Signal Description
1 1   GND Ground
2 2 1 GND Ground
3 3 14 DIN21+ High-speed differential input #21 – Positive pole
4 4 2 DIN21- High-speed differential input #21 – Negative pole
5 5 15 DIN22+ High-speed differential input #22 – Positive pole
6 6 3 DIN22- High-speed differential input #22 – Negative pole
7 7 16 IIN21+ Isolated input #21 – Positive pole
8 8 4 IIN21- Isolated input #21 – Negative pole
9 9 17 IIN22+ Isolated input #22 – Positive pole
10 10 5 IIN22- Isolated input #22 – Negative pole
11 11 18 IIN23+ Isolated input #23 – Positive pole
12 12 6 IIN23- Isolated input #23 – Negative pole
13 13 19 IIN24+ Isolated input #24 – Positive pole
14 14 7 IIN24- Isolated input #24 – Negative pole
15 15 20 IOUT21+ Isolated contact output #21 – Positive pole
16 16 8 IOUT21- Isolated contact output #21 – Negative pole
17 17 21 IOUT22+ Isolated contact output #22 – Positive pole
18 18 9 IOUT22- Isolated contact output #22 – Negative pole
19 19 22 TTLIO21 TTL input/output #21
20 20 10 GND Ground (TTLIO21 return)
21 21 23 TTLIO22 TTL input/output #22
22 22 11 GND Ground (TTLIO22 return)
23 23 24 - Not used
24 24 12 GND Ground
25 25 25 +12V +12 V Power output
26 26 13 GND Ground (+12V return)

Usage with Internal IO1 connector

Applies to:

The adapter brings the second set of I/O lines and the +12V power output to a bracket-mount SubD connector. The pins are assigned as follows:

Wire # IDC Pin # SubD Pin # Signal Name Signal Description
1 1   GND Ground
2 2 1 GND Ground
3 3 14 DIN11+ High-speed differential input #11 – Positive pole
4 4 2 DIN11- High-speed differential input #11 – Negative pole
5 5 15 DIN12+ High-speed differential input #12 – Positive pole
6 6 3 DIN12- High-speed differential input #12 – Negative pole
7 7 16 IIN11+ Isolated input #11 – Positive pole
8 8 4 IIN11- Isolated input #11 – Negative pole
9 9 17 IIN12+ Isolated input #12 – Positive pole
10 10 5 IIN12- Isolated input #12 – Negative pole
11 11 18 IIN13+ Isolated input #13 – Positive pole
12 12 6 IIN13- Isolated input #13 – Negative pole
13 13 19 IIN14+ Isolated input #14 – Positive pole
14 14 7 IIN14- Isolated input #14 – Negative pole
15 15 20 IOUT11+ Isolated contact output #11 – Positive pole
16 16 8 IOUT11- Isolated contact output #11 – Negative pole
17 17 21 IOUT12+ Isolated contact output #12 – Positive pole
18 18 9 IOUT12- Isolated contact output #12 – Negative pole
19 19 22 TTLIO11 TTL input/output #11
20 20 10 GND Ground (TTLIO11 return)
21 21 23 TTLIO12 TTL input/output #12
22 22 11 GND Ground (TTLIO12 return)
23 23 24 - Not used
24 24 12 GND Ground
25 25 25 +12V +12 V Power output
26 26 13 GND Ground (+12V return)
